* WHO We Are:

** Self-Help started in 1980 with a focus on economic inequality especially in communities that have faced systemic barriers in building wealth. At the core of what Self-Help does is a drive to create and protect ownership and economic opportunity. In other words, we’re committed to economic justice! Economic Justice means that all communities have the basic infrastructure they need to thrive, from high-quality schools to grocery stores selling fresh food resources that support opportunity at a neighborhood level regardless of demographics, income, or wealth.

Since our founding, we’ve constantly sought to find new ways to pursue greater economic justice: from providing fair and affordable loans to working with partners to demand that lawmakers change unjust policies.

** WHAT You'll do:
**** MEMBER SERVICING AND CASH HANDLING
*** Greet and welcome members and visitors to the credit union in a friendly and professional manner. Provide prompt, efficient, and accurate service.
* Promote credit union products and services based on members’ needs.
* Open new membership accounts.
* Provide information concerning credit union products and services in person, by telephone, or email.
* Respond to members’ inquiries and requests. Resolve problems and complaints or escalate them as appropriate while acting as a liaison between other staff and the member.
* Perform account transactions including deposits, withdrawals, loan payments, CD transactions, lines of credit advances, account transfers, imaging receipts, etc. Perform account maintenance including adding joint owners, address changes, and competing any other necessary MSR functions.
* Refer mortgage loan requests to Mortgage Loan Assistants or Mortgage Loan Officers.
* Open, balance, and close cash drawer when serving in MSR capacity. Maintain appropriate cash levels in drawers based on branch’s cash drawer limits.
* May handle Vault responsibilities including managing branch and MSR cash supply, when needed.
* Assist with mailed-in, ATM, night deposits, and/or ATM balancing, when needed.
** CONSUMER LENDING
*** Manage the entire consumer loan process from initiation through closing, including interviewing loan applicants, determining loan eligibility, reviewing applications for accuracy and providing timely and accurate disclosures while operating with moderate credit authority and complying with the credit union's lending policies.
* Prepares file for underwriting by reviewing and analyzing documentation from borrowers to determine validity and authenticity; maintain communication with underwriter to provide clarification or additional information, if requested.
* Monitor processing progress to ensure loan file is ready for closing in a timely manner.
* Provide financial counseling to members at their request or when evidence indicates there are financial difficulties.
* Recommend deposit and loan products best suited to meet each member's unique needs.
** BUSINESS DEVELOPMENT/OTHER
*** Promote the Credit Union to individuals and groups in the community and participate in business development efforts to promote Self-Help lending products including mortgage, consumer loan, and all other products as needed.
* Perform various administrative tasks.
* Mail receipts and checks to members as indicated by policy and procedure.
* Research accounts for deposit, withdrawal, and loan-payment discrepancies.
* Act as role model for MSR staff and provide coaching and development of staff for identifying products that will meet customer needs.
* Assist branch management with filing and record retention of daily reports
* In the absence of the MSR Supervisor, may provide supervisor overrides for cash withdrawals up to $5,000.
* Supervise opening/closing procedures in supervisor and manager’s absence.
* When requested, may supervise MSR staff in the absence of the supervisor, assistant branch manager and branch manager.
